Output 8e6a43c3b77513e29e1b7463aaa4f961467d7553183413d00a1827492cd02bb2:9

value
655062
script pubkey
OP_HASH160 OP_PUSHBYTES_20 42eb2318ee0f7e2dd7366717fd092d4c6465e4b7 OP_EQUAL
address
37nrCpKPbF9wov2LJMRN11dxGfd6z5inrD
transaction
8e6a43c3b77513e29e1b7463aaa4f961467d7553183413d00a1827492cd02bb2